Customized i8000 WM6.5 Lite ROM (English version only)

JB1 - JB3 - JC1 - JC2 -21897 - Euro JC1 - JD4 - JE2 - JF5

I originally intended to make this Lite ROM for my own use.

However, I decided to post it and share with the community.

I have increased free ram and the base ram by changing the

PagePool to 8MB.

For wallpaper customization please visit: Wallpapers

Thanks to Lancez, Previa and Contable for the wallpaper thread.

18 July 2010: JF5 Lite version

ROM specifications:

- ROM based WM 6.5 build 21895.5.0.90

- Preserved: many programs that I like

- Kept Samsung Today Home Screen

- Samsung Widgets screen removed

- Added: new power_on/power_off screens with sound - Thanks Dande!!

- Disabled File Signing/Certificate checking

- SDKCerts installed

- Did not remove the following per requests: MSMoney, MSN Weather, Marketplace

- added 4-col Start Menu (Portrait) 10-col Start Menu (Landscape)

- Includes Mobile Office 10

- Added MySoftReset program

- Added DCIM_Date mortscript to change DCIM to today's date

- Removed Opera - install whichever version you like

- Able to adjust PagePool with utility provided - READ Instructions Please

*** READ Readme & AppLauncher Instructions in Rom zip file BEFORE flashing ***

- JE2: About 238MB program storage and 94MB free ram

See attached screen shots.

post-557795-1279448877_thumb.jpgpost-557795-1279448919_thumb.jpg

post-557795-1279448932_thumb.jpgpost-557795-1279448953_thumb.jpg

I take no responsibility for you flashing this ROM. It works for me.

Note:

- This is a Lite version. Your memory/mileage may vary.

- Flash with Octans v2.14 - been using this since it was released

Guest Gary Crutcher
How to remove added shortcuts?

go to:

\Windows\Start Menu\Programs

delete shortcuts you do not want

maybe have to reboot phone to clear cache
